5. David is scuba diving 23 ft below the surface. His friend Raul is diving 61 ft below the surface. What is the difference in the depths of the two divers?​

Answer:

38ft

Explanation:

When you see the word difference it means to subtract. If you subtract 61-23 you get 38 so the difference in depth of the two divers is 38ft.
